Information on the Target

Lisi Medical is a prominent contract development and manufacturing organization (CDMO) within the MedTech sector, specializing in the production of high-precision metal components and assemblies. The company primarily serves global medical device original equipment manufacturers (OEMs), providing critical components used in minimally invasive and robotic-assisted surgeries as well as orthopedic implants.

With a robust operational footprint that includes four manufacturing facilities—two located in Minnesota, USA, and two in France—Lisi Medical boasts a wealth of expertise in precision machining, forging, and engineering solutions. Its highly automated production processes ensure high quality and efficiency, positioning the company as a key player in the medical technology market.

The Rationale Behind the Deal

SK Capital’s decision to engage in exclusive negotiations to acquire Lisi Medical’s Medical division aligns with its strategy to bolster its portfolio in the specialty materials and life sciences sectors. The investment is anticipated to catalyze Lisi Medical's growth trajectory by forging deeper relationships with existing customers while onboarding new clients.

Moreover, SK Capital's backing will allow Lisi Medical to enhance its operational capabilities both organically and through future mergers and acquisitions. This ensures that Lisi Medical can adapt to the changing landscape of the MedTech industry effectively, maintaining a competitive edge.

Information About the Investor

SK Capital is a well-established private investment firm headquartered in New York, with a sharp focus on sectors such as specialty materials, ingredients, and life sciences. The firm leverages its deep industry knowledge and operational expertise to identify and nurture companies that have the potential for significant value creation.

With a diverse portfolio comprising several successful investments, SK Capital emphasizes growth through innovation and strategic development. The firm’s philosophy is centered on fostering long-term partnerships and providing the necessary resources to accelerate the growth of its portfolio companies, making it a suitable investor for Lisi Medical at this pivotal time in its growth journey.
